The system has an anti-jitter mechanism for the storage pool capacity alarm. The system uses 1% of the total capacity as the anti-jitter range. A capacity alarm is cleared only after the storage pool capacity becomes smaller than alarm threshold plus the anti-jitter range. For example, if the default capacity alarm threshold is 80%, an alarm is generated once the capacity actually used is greater than or equal to 80%. When the capacity actually used becomes lower than 79%, the capacity alarm is cleared.
Solutions for the capacity alarm:
1. Expand the storage pool capacity.
2. If you do not want to expand the storage pool capacity, you can increase the alarm threshold to a maximum value of 85%.
3. Contact Huawei technical support.
A capacity alarm is reported only for storage pools that have thin LUNs or thin file systems.
